Output 8c2bec28e6fa01424729aff67da6cb7ffaf0ebfb6f4ecccf412d2c80fde5f950:1

value
11135903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b8dd34fbaa918d85cbd2b6b28dadb058affd2bd OP_EQUAL
address
3LFJzgwANomCHmdZ3YALTiRsZZQerdd4AK
transaction
8c2bec28e6fa01424729aff67da6cb7ffaf0ebfb6f4ecccf412d2c80fde5f950
confirmations
288762
spent
true